When you sell in the Canary Islands your costs come off the sale price: capital gains tax on your profit, the municipal plusvalía to the town hall (due within 30 days), and a handful of fixed items — energy certificate, nota simple, and mortgage cancellation if applicable. Non-resident sellers also have 3% of the price retained at the notary on account of tax, reclaimable if the real tax due is lower.
